How they compare
Nicaragua currently reports 274,711 against 244,293 in Botswana, a difference of 30,418.
That makes Nicaragua's figure about 1.1 times Botswana's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 8 shared years of data; in 2012 it was Nicaragua ahead.
Botswana ranks 60th and Nicaragua ranks 57th of 177 countries.
Nicaragua has averaged higher in every one of the 1 decades both report.

About this data
Net food imports are generated from FAOSTAT, taking Export level (tonnes) from the Import level (tonnes) [both under Trade: Crops and Livestock Products]. Net food imports are a proxy for the country's vulnerability to global food prices.
